What's The Definition Of Disembarkment?
[n] the act of passengers and crew getting off of a ship or aircraft
Synonyms | Synonyms for Disembarkment: debarkation | disembarkation Related Terms | Find terms related to Disembarkment: See Also | going ashore | landing Disembarkment In Webster's Dictionary \Dis`em*bark"ment\, n.
Disembarkation. [R.]
